Thank you for providing shelter to the hurting
|
Thanks to supporters like you, this year over 100 women, children and men fleeing domestic violence have found a safe haven at our shelter,
Carol's House.
Thank you for keeping the lights on, keeping the bedrooms warm, providing nutritious food and making the shelter feel more like a home for a little while.

Thank you to the
Boys & Girls Foundation
for their grant supporting our Art Therapy program at our Therapeutic Children's Center.
CRC's Therapeutic Children's Center provides a safe place for children to begin to heal from domestic violence at our shelter.
